WebSydney's gardens, parks, ponds, houses and buildings provide opportunities for many species to thrive. The outer suburbs, particularly those close to one of national parks that surround the city, have a great diversity of wildlife. Native plants attract insects, spiders and birds, lizards and if there is water nearby, frogs. Sydney is Australia's most populous city, and is also the most populous city in Oceania. In the 2024 census, 5,231,147 persons declared themselves as residents of the Sydney Statistical Division–about one-fifth (20.58%) of Australia's total population.
